Comparing Belize with Kansas City, Kansas

Compare Climate information for Belize and Kansas City, Kansas

Is Belize warmer or hotter than Kansas City, Kansas?

On average across the year, yes, Belize is hotter than Kansas City, Kansas . Belize has an average temperature of 28°C/82°F and Kansas City, Kansas has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F.

Belize's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 35°C/95°F, which is hotter than Kansas City, Kansas's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).

Is Belize colder or cooler than Kansas City, Kansas?

On average across the year, no, Belize is not colder than Kansas City, Kansas . Belize has an average minimum temperature of 23°C/73°F and Kansas City, Kansas has an average minimum temperature of 9°C/48°F.



Belize's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 19°C/66°F, which is not colder than Kansas City, Kansas's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-5°C/23°F).

Does Belize have more rain than Kansas City, Kansas?

On average across the year, no, Belize has less rain than Kansas City, Kansas. Belize has an average annual rainfall of 835mm and Kansas City, Kansas has an average annual rainfall of 875mm.

Belize's wettest month is October, with an average monthly rainfall of 187mm, which is wetter than Kansas City, Kansas's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 147mm).
